Toy bomb blast deprives teenager of both hands

MIRAN SHAH: Toy bomb explosion amputated both hands of a teenager in tehsil Miran Shah of North Waziristan district on Sunday.

Rescue sources said that a 13-year old boy found a toy bomb while collecting fuel wood in mountainous of Miran Shah found a toy bomb.

While playing with it, the toy bomb went off with big bang depriving the boy of boy hands.

The injured boy was shifted to District Headquarter Hospital Miran Shah where he was referred to Khalif Gulnawaz Hospital Bannu due to critical condition.
